    I have experience working with children, adolescents, adults, couples, and families in counseling, educational, and ministry settings. My work includes supporting clients experiencing anxiety, depression, life transitions, relationship challenges, emotional stress, and identity concerns. My counseling approach is warm, collaborative, and culturally responsive, grounded in person-centered principles while integrating practical coping strategies and emotional insight. With backgrounds in psychology, technology, and multicultural experiences, I bring both empathy and thoughtful curiosity to the therapeutic process. I believe meaningful change begins when clients feel genuinely seen, accepted, and understood. Together, we work to increase self-awareness, process difficult emotions, strengthen relationships, and develop healthier patterns of coping. I provide counseling in both English and Mandarin and strive to create a safe, nonjudgmental space where clients can explore their strengths and move toward greater resilience and authenticity.
